.ric is the index file for MpGuide 6.5. You get an equivalent xml index file
created by gdal (gdal notes web page) when you add your tiffs. the .tfw
files contain the extens for the tif files but if your tiffs are geotiffs
then these would already contain this extent info within its header. You can
view the xml index file by clicking on the Edit optiion within MG connection
page. make sure the coordinate system is the same as your map's coord
system. Also make sure that the extents within the coordinate system are
good enough to enclose all of your tifs.
